Statin Therapy in Ischemic Stroke Models: A Meta-Analysis
AbstractStatins, drugs known for lipid lowering capabilities and reduction of cardiovascular disease, have demonstrated neuroprotective effects following ischemic stroke in retrospective clinical and animal studies. However, dosing (methods, time, type of statin, and quantity) varies across studies, limiting the clinical applicability of these findings. Furthermore, a comprehensive review of statins in edema and blood-brain barrier (BBB) breakdown is needed to provide insight on diverse, less explored neuroprotective effects. In the present study, we conduct a meta-analysis of publications evaluating statin administration ...

Statin and dual antiplatelet therapy for the prevention of early neurological deterioration and recurrent stroke in branch atheromatous disease: a protocol for a prospective single-arm study using a historical control for comparison
Introduction Branch atheromatous disease (BAD) contributes to small-vessel occlusion in cases of occlusion or stenosis of large calibre penetrating arteries, and it is associated with a higher possibility of early neurological deterioration (END) and recurrent stroke in acute ischaemic stroke. As the pathology of BAD is due to atherosclerosis, we postulate that early intensive medical treatment with dual antiplatelet therapy (DAPT) and high-intensity statins may prevent END and recurrent stroke in acute small subcortical infarction caused by BAD. Methods and analysis In this prospective, single-centre, open-label, non-ran...

Protective Effects of Different Classes, Intensity, Cumulative Dose-Dependent of Statins Against Primary Ischemic Stroke in Patients with Type 2 Diabetes Mellitus
AbstractPurpose of ReviewThe aim of this study is to investigate the protective effects of different statin classes, intensity, and cumulative dose-dependent against primary ischemic stroke in patients with T2DM.Recent FindingsThe Cox hazards model was used to evaluate statin use on primary ischemic stroke. Case group: T2DM patients who received statins; control group: T2DM patients who received no statins during the follow-up. Adjusted hazard ratio (aHR) for primary ischemic stroke was 0.45 (95% CI: 0.44 to 0.46). Cox regression analysis showed significant reductions in primary ischemic stroke incidence in users of differ...
